Inside the De Havilland Comet: Vintage Jet Airliner Interior Design

The de Havilland Comet, an icon of aviation history, revolutionized air travel as the world’s first commercial jetliner. Introduced in the early 1950s, its advanced design captured the public imagination and promised a new era of speed and comfort. While much attention focuses on the aircraft’s groundbreaking exterior structure and pioneering jet engines, the interior of the Comet was equally significant, defining the passenger experience and setting new standards for cabin design. Understanding the de Havilland Comet interior provides a crucial perspective on how air travel evolved from the opulence of the propeller era into the streamlined age of jet propulsion.

Design Philosophy and Layout

The interior design of the Comet was a deliberate departure from the noisy, turbulent, and often claustrophobic cabins of its piston-engine predecessors. The goal was to leverage the jet engine’s inherent advantages—smooth, quiet operation and higher speeds—to create a more refined environment. The cabin was configured with a relatively wide cross-section for the time, allowing for a 2-2 seating arrangement without the center seats that plagued narrower aircraft. This layout provided passengers with a more spacious feel and easier access to the aisle, a significant comfort improvement for the era’s long-haul routes.

Cabin Pressure and Window Design

A revolutionary aspect of the Comet’s design was its pressurized cabin, which allowed it to fly higher and smoother than aircraft constrained by ambient air pressure. This innovation directly influenced the passenger environment, reducing fatigue and the feeling of ear congestion. The large, square windows, a signature feature of the Comet, were not merely an aesthetic choice; they were strategically placed to maximize natural light and provide passengers with breathtaking panoramic views. The psychological impact of these expansive views, combined with the reduced cabin altitude, created a sense of openness that was revolutionary in 1950s commercial aviation.

Materials and Aesthetics

The material palette used in the Comet’s cabin was carefully selected to convey a sense of luxury and modernity. Unlike the wood and fabric common in older aircraft, the interior featured extensive use of polished aluminum, chrome plating, and high-quality plastics. Overhead bins were streamlined to minimize turbulence noise, and the cabin walls were often covered in textured plastic or painted aluminum panels that were both durable and easy to clean. The lighting was another key element; the absence of the constant engine rumble allowed for more subtle and ambient lighting schemes, enhancing the feeling of a sophisticated lounge in the sky rather than a utilitarian transport vessel.

Passenger Experience and Service

Flying on the Comet was marketed as a premium experience, and the service reflected this positioning. The smooth, quiet flight allowed for conversation and even dining without the constant background noise of a propeller-driven plane. Meals were served on fine china and glassware, a stark contrast to the metal trays and paper cups often associated with early air travel. The de Havilland Comet interior was designed to facilitate service, with galley areas that allowed flight attendants to move efficiently through the cabin, ensuring that the promise of a premium journey was met with attentive care.

Challenges and Evolution

Despite its initial acclaim, the Comet’s career was marred by catastrophic metal fatigue failures in the pressurized fuselage. These tragedies led to a complete redesign of the aircraft, which had a profound impact on the interior. The redesigned Comet 4 featured a slightly longer fuselage, a more conventional window layout, and reinforced structures. While the core aesthetic remained, the lessons learned from the failures resulted in a more robust and reliable cabin environment. The experience underscored the importance of engineering integrity in maintaining the luxurious and safe interior environment that the jet age promised.
